Minou Djawdan is a scholar working on Ecology, Evolution, Behavior and Systematics, Ecology and Aging. According to data from OpenAlex, Minou Djawdan has authored 8 papers receiving a total of 780 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Ecology, Evolution, Behavior and Systematics, 7 papers in Ecology and 2 papers in Aging. Recurrent topics in Minou Djawdan's work include Physiological and biochemical adaptations (7 papers), Animal Behavior and Reproduction (5 papers) and Animal Ecology and Behavior Studies (2 papers). Minou Djawdan is often cited by papers focused on Physiological and biochemical adaptations (7 papers), Animal Behavior and Reproduction (5 papers) and Animal Ecology and Behavior Studies (2 papers). Minou Djawdan collaborates with scholars based in United States. Minou Djawdan's co-authors include Michael R. Rose, Timothy J. Bradley, Adam K. Chippindale, Theodore Garland, Allen G. Gibbs, Mani Sheik and Timothy J. Bradley and has published in prestigious journals such as Ecology, Evolution and Functional Ecology.
